Peter Robinson
0c5496756d
Update AMD xgbe a0 aarch64 driver for 4.1
2015-04-22 22:45:54 +01:00
Josh Boyer
2f4d269b2d
Upload git12 patch
...
move build NVR to latest commit
2015-04-22 10:55:11 -04:00
Peter Robinson
9c16b2432a
Inital ARM updates for 4.1, Temporarily disable AMD ARM64 xgbe-a0 driver
2015-04-22 15:51:31 +01:00
Josh Boyer
2bfd285dcd
Linux v4.0-9804-gdb4fd9c5d072
2015-04-22 10:16:54 -04:00
Josh Boyer
3c73a96030
Linux v4.0-9362-g1fc149933fd4
2015-04-21 14:48:42 -04:00
Josh Boyer
96ebb7b6ef
Enable ECHO driver (rhbz 749884)
2015-04-21 09:05:07 -04:00
Josh Boyer
cbe4b5e00e
Linux v4.0-8962-g14aa02449064
...
DRM merge
2015-04-20 20:37:31 -04:00
Dennis Gilmore
c8c0485222
Enable mvebu on the lpae kernel
...
It has LPAE, there are boards that can have more than 4GiB ram. Anaconda
defaults to installing LPAE when the hardware supports it, so any install
today will not work post install.
Signed-off-by: Dennis Gilmore <dennis@ausil.us>
2015-04-20 09:05:55 -04:00
Josh Boyer
ed8080d353
Linux v4.0-8158-g09d51602cf84
2015-04-20 08:58:25 -04:00
Josh Boyer
814e7c84f7
Linux v4.0-7945-g7505256626b0
2015-04-18 10:28:40 -04:00
Josh Boyer
8b91e0bbd8
Linux v4.0-7300-g4fc8adcfec3d
...
- Patch from Benjamin Tissoires to fix 3 finger tap on synaptics (rhbz 1212230)
- Add patch to support touchpad on Google Pixel 2 (rhbz 1209088)
2015-04-17 09:31:16 -04:00
Josh Boyer
9b68c8a1f7
Linux v4.0-7209-g7d69cff26cea
2015-04-17 08:33:28 -04:00
Josh Boyer
d72c260b23
Linux v4.0-7084-g497a5df7bf6f
2015-04-16 16:29:34 -04:00
Josh Boyer
84326caccc
Linux v4.0-6817-geea3a00264cf
2015-04-16 10:55:18 -04:00
Josh Boyer
96d2a08f32
Linux v4.0-5833-g6c373ca89399
2015-04-15 15:51:31 -04:00
Josh Boyer
cc7213fcfe
Linux v4.0-3843-gbb0fd7ab0986
2015-04-15 10:47:18 -04:00
Josh Boyer
b18e6e7536
Linux v4.0-2620-gb79013b2449c
2015-04-14 09:55:36 -04:00
Josh Boyer
85afd6960d
Linux v4.0
2015-04-13 05:37:18 -04:00
Josh Boyer
bbace1218a
Linux v4.0-rc7-42-ge5e02de0665e
2015-04-10 10:58:53 -04:00
Josh Boyer
5fbe6a96e1
Linux v4.0-rc7-30-g20624d17963c
2015-04-09 10:00:06 -04:00
Josh Boyer
b6b5f47a14
Linux v4.0-rc6-101-g0a4812798fae
2015-04-02 16:46:55 -04:00
Josh Boyer
92f85ec311
DoS against IPv6 stacks due to improper handling of RA (rhbz 1203712 1208491)
2015-04-02 08:23:52 -04:00
Josh Boyer
c0c5b9742f
Linux v4.0-rc6-31-gd4039314d0b1
...
- CVE-2015-2150 xen: NMIs triggerable by guests (rhbz 1196266 1200397)
2015-04-01 20:24:22 -04:00
Josh Boyer
9adfc18494
CVE-2015-2150 xen: NMIs triggerable by guests (rhbz 1196266 1200397)
...
Part deux: Fix it harder
2015-04-01 08:38:46 -04:00
Josh Boyer
8a2fdf2bb5
Enable MLX4_EN_VXLAN (rhbz 1207728)
2015-03-31 11:15:01 -04:00
Josh Boyer
e2f558b75c
Linux v4.0-rc6
2015-03-30 09:07:13 -04:00
Josh Boyer
41c0069fbc
Linux v4.0-rc5-96-g3c435c1e472b
...
- Fixes hangs due to i915 issues (rhbz 1204050 1206056)
2015-03-27 09:22:16 -04:00
Josh Boyer
2aa3606074
Linux v4.0-rc5-80-g4c4fe4c24782
2015-03-26 09:21:41 -04:00
Peter Robinson
b4512393ac
Add aarch64 patches to fix mustang usb, seattle eth, and console settings
2015-03-26 01:14:45 +00:00
Josh Boyer
b6d84528bc
Add patches to fix a few more i915 hangs/oopses
2015-03-25 17:36:04 -04:00
Josh Boyer
9d4f1f0029
Linux v4.0-rc5-53-gc875f421097a
2015-03-25 13:09:36 -04:00
Josh Boyer
243dfca335
Fix ALPS v5 and v7 trackpads (rhbz 1203584)
2015-03-24 12:33:03 -04:00
Josh Boyer
6b33b74760
Linux v4.0-rc5-25-g90a5a895cc8b
...
- Add some i915 fixes
2015-03-24 12:13:19 -04:00
Peter Robinson
04612c67bb
drop aarch64patches. No functional change
2015-03-24 14:44:47 +00:00
Josh Boyer
c91c5960a0
Enable CONFIG_SND_BEBOB (rhbz 1204342)
2015-03-23 15:16:34 -04:00
Josh Boyer
ebfb149da3
Validate iovec range in sys_sendto/sys_recvfrom
2015-03-23 15:10:23 -04:00
Josh Boyer
68ca5f5500
Revert i915 commit that causes boot hangs on at least some headless machines
2015-03-23 15:07:31 -04:00
Josh Boyer
332f9893c3
Linux v4.0-rc5
2015-03-23 15:05:09 -04:00
Josh Boyer
fd83f61c73
Fix brightness on Lenovo Ideapad Z570 (rhbz 1187004)
2015-03-20 11:35:18 -04:00
Josh Boyer
7dd6861011
Linux v4.0-rc4-199-gb314acaccd7e
2015-03-20 11:28:46 -04:00
Josh Boyer
287e820f02
Linux v4.0-rc4-88-g7b09ac704bac
...
- Rename arm64-xgbe-a0.patch
2015-03-19 16:05:37 -04:00
Peter Robinson
1b5309d39e
Drop the big arm64 patch, just pull in the specific patches we need to fix specific problems
2015-03-19 18:16:51 +00:00
Jarod Wilson
b554910d7a
The package and description definitions should always match
...
The %package foo and %description foo bits should always match. If you use
-n for one, use it for the other, and vice versa.
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-19 10:31:03 -04:00
Josh Boyer
4751d6e935
Add patch to fix high cpu usage on direct_read kernfs files (rhbz 1202362)
2015-03-19 09:11:13 -04:00
Jarod Wilson
cde0b0eb7a
The if conditional needs quotes here, apparently
...
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-18 12:03:40 -04:00
Jarod Wilson
8a29c59170
Add k-var-headers Obsoletes/Provides
...
When doing a variant build, you want kernel-variant-headers to Obsoletes:
and Provides: kernel-headers, so that it can upgrade/replace
kernel-headers. Otherwise, attempting to install kernel-variant-headers
leads to rpm spewing file conflicts with kernel-headers, if installed.
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-18 11:54:28 -04:00
Jarod Wilson
a96d89f582
Fix kernel-uname-r Requires/Provides variant mismatches
...
There was some discontinuity between the Requires and Provides with
respect to variant builds. They have to match, or you wind up with variant
builds that can't install w/o forcing them to ignore dependencies.
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-18 10:38:54 -04:00
Kyle McMartin
6d8ef07aa7
enable PCI_ECAM
2015-03-17 11:35:38 -04:00
Kyle McMartin
139d2905d4
tag for build
2015-03-17 11:17:36 -04:00
Kyle McMartin
c39d858a6e
update kernel-arm64.patch, move EDAC to arm-generic, add EDAC_XGENE on arm64
2015-03-17 11:10:15 -04:00
Jarod Wilson
0cd8df96b5
Fix bad variant usage in kernel dependencies
...
This was resulting in a variant build with dependencies like so:
error: Failed dependencies:
kernel--vanilla-core-uname-r = ...
The variant already has a - at the start of it, so the always-there one
should be after variant and variant will provide the one between kernel
and itself.
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-17 09:13:01 -04:00
Josh Boyer
35466ad3b6
Drop upstreamed quirk patches that still apply
...
Yay patch(1) for letting these get doubly applied.
2015-03-17 09:02:54 -04:00
Josh Boyer
9608f11d20
Linux v4.0-rc4
...
- Drop arm64 RCU revert patch. Should be fixed properly upstream now.
- Disable debugging options.
2015-03-16 10:07:00 -04:00
Jarod Wilson
cd37906b18
And one more missing -n for kernel-tools
...
Yeah, I shouldn't be committing things to the Fedora kernel tree when I
haven't done so in years, and its after 2am on a Saturday night. I promise
I haven't been drinking though...
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-15 02:10:02 -04:00
Jarod Wilson
831c8c2758
Oops, missed a few more -n for kernel-tools
...
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-15 02:08:25 -04:00
Jarod Wilson
7220f8a9ca
Fix kernel-tools sub-packages for variant builds
...
If you try rebuilding with a %variant set, you'll hit:
error: line 2026: Package does not exist: %post -n kernel-tools
In the %post defs, we had '%post -n kernel-tools', while the package was
named simply '%package tools', which for the base kernel build, meant they
worked out to the same thing, but if doing say a kernel-vanilla build, you
had kernel-vanilla-tools and kernel-tools mismatching. This fixes the
inconsistency.
Signed-off-by: Jarod Wilson <jarod@redhat.com>
2015-03-15 02:02:19 -04:00
Josh Boyer
02a7d0ba14
Fix esrt build on aarch64
...
Tested via cross build with:
[jwboyer@vader linux]$ aarch64-linux-gnu-gcc --version
aarch64-linux-gnu-gcc (GCC) 4.9.1 20140717 (Red Hat Cross 4.9.1-1)
2015-03-13 15:26:01 -04:00
Kyle McMartin
10b2b756c8
revert ESRT on AArch64 for now
2015-03-13 12:57:01 -04:00
Kyle McMartin
088b1f27a9
arm64-revert-tlb-rcu_table_free.patch: revert 5e5f6dc1
...
which causes lockups on arm64 machines.
2015-03-13 12:38:27 -04:00
Josh Boyer
62a6befde2
Add patch to support clickpads (rhbz 1201532)
2015-03-13 09:47:14 -04:00
Peter Jones
bbf3f54706
Add ESRT patch here.
...
Signed-off-by: Peter Jones <pjones@redhat.com>
2015-03-13 08:31:07 -04:00
Josh Boyer
283bd0665f
Linux v4.0-rc3-148-gc202baf017ae
2015-03-13 08:26:48 -04:00
Josh Boyer
32dcd3a968
CVE-2014-8159 infiniband: uverbs: unprotected physical memory access (rhbz 1181166 1200950)
2015-03-12 08:47:38 -04:00
Josh Boyer
ac03c510f0
CVE-2015-2150 xen: NMIs triggerable by guests (rhbz 1196266 1200397)
2015-03-11 10:19:15 -04:00
Josh Boyer
00acd3eec4
Revert synaptics patch
...
Benjamin says this hurts more than it helps
2015-03-11 09:19:42 -04:00
Josh Boyer
80e48d0c7e
Patch series to fix Lenovo *40 and Carbon X1 touchpads (rhbz 1200777 1200778)
2015-03-11 09:18:03 -04:00
Josh Boyer
7394705294
Revert commit that added bad rpath to cpupower (rhbz 1199312)
2015-03-11 08:51:02 -04:00
Josh Boyer
853ea7612f
Linux v4.0-rc3-111-gaffb8172de39
...
- Reenable debugging options.
2015-03-11 08:48:06 -04:00
Josh Boyer
4c98a00d3e
Add patch to fix DMA-API warning from rtsx_usb driver
2015-03-10 08:36:30 -04:00
Josh Boyer
3be331969c
Linux v4.0-rc3
...
- Disable debugging options.
2015-03-09 09:12:49 -04:00
Peter Robinson
94f21fb741
ARMv7: add patches to fix crash on boot for some devices on multiplatform
2015-03-08 23:50:13 +00:00
Josh Boyer
382c3e3884
Linux v4.0-rc2-255-g5f237425f352
2015-03-06 15:18:56 -05:00
Josh Boyer
3168389a4e
Linux v4.0-rc2-150-g6587457b4b3d
...
- Reenable debugging options.
2015-03-05 09:30:32 -05:00
Josh Boyer
432f3aca12
Enable MLX4_EN on ppc64/aarch64 (rhbz 1198719)
2015-03-04 13:14:15 -05:00
Josh Boyer
9633911b56
Linux v4.0-rc2
...
- Enable CONFIG_CM32181 for ALS on Carbon X1
- Disable debugging options.
2015-03-03 15:52:27 -05:00
Josh Boyer
8ea4731c38
Drop kernel-arm64-fix-psci-when-pg.patch
...
Upstream went with a different solution to the problem by moving the functions
to their own .S files. Seems overkill but whatever.
2015-03-03 09:54:59 -05:00
Josh Boyer
3b35d75b8c
Linux v4.0-rc1-178-g023a6007a08d
2015-03-03 09:00:03 -05:00
Josh Boyer
2939fc47bc
Add patch to fix nfsd soft lockup (rhbz 1185519)
2015-03-02 14:17:37 -05:00
Josh Boyer
80f3c652dd
Enable ET131X driver (rhbz 1197842)
2015-03-02 14:00:32 -05:00
Josh Boyer
ebce054077
Enable YAMA (rhbz 1196825)
2015-03-02 10:16:47 -05:00
Peter Robinson
e6b799b67d
ARMv7 OMAP updates, fix panda boot
2015-02-28 18:55:52 +00:00
Josh Boyer
e8cacb9980
Linux v4.0-rc1-36-g4f671fe2f952
2015-02-27 08:23:12 -05:00
Josh Boyer
b9064f3f32
Add support for AR5B195 devices from Alexander Ploumistos (rhbz 1190947)
2015-02-25 15:32:01 -05:00
Josh Boyer
adc659526c
Linux v4.0-rc1-22-gb24e2bdde4af
...
- Reenable debugging options.
Fixup one more 3.x place and make sure we don't apply the -rcX patch in yet
another spot.
2015-02-24 17:49:49 -05:00
Richard W.M. Jones
f7bbaa5ad9
Add patch to fix aarch64 KVM bug with module loading (rhbz 1194366).
2015-02-24 18:25:10 +00:00
Peter Robinson
e587feee2d
Minor ARM config update
2015-02-24 12:51:16 +00:00
Josh Boyer
2288d59f27
Missed a hack
...
We're using the -rcX tarballs, so we don't need to apply the patch-4.0-rcX
patch. It wasn't actually being applied, but the SRPM rebuild in koji fails
because we list it as Patch00 and it doesn't exist.
2015-02-23 15:43:04 -05:00
Josh Boyer
a36e7653df
Add patch for HID i2c from Seth Forshee (rhbz 1188439)
2015-02-23 15:08:16 -05:00
Josh Boyer
d7293323e7
Linux v4.0-rc1
...
- CVE-2015-0275 ext4: fallocate zero range page size > block size BUG (rhbz 1193907 1195178)
- Disable debugging options.
Yay for major version bumps :\.
We grab the full rc1 tarball instead of just the patch to make this way less
messy in the spec. When 4.0 final is released, we'll need to undo a few
specific hacks. Namely, we need to redefine:
upstream_sublevel
kversion
Source0
back to the standard definitions.
Thanks to Kyle for figuring this out 3 years ago.
2015-02-23 11:30:23 -05:00
Josh Boyer
2296e4a647
Linux v3.19-8975-g3d883483dc0a
...
- Add patch to fix intermittent hangs in nouveau driver
- Move mtpspi and related mods to kernel-core for VMWare guests (rhbz 1194612)
2015-02-20 09:32:10 -05:00
Josh Boyer
6bfe64015d
Linux v3.19-8784-gb2b89ebfc0f0
2015-02-18 16:50:20 -05:00
Kyle McMartin
25e750dec7
fixes to arm64
2015-02-18 15:38:08 -05:00
Josh Boyer
ef4846b795
Linux v3.19-8217-gcc4f9c2a91b7
2015-02-18 11:53:33 -05:00
Josh Boyer
0292d3421e
Shoot the cow.
2015-02-17 14:48:01 -05:00
Kyle McMartin
d528d958cc
fix the cow banner
2015-02-17 14:21:45 -05:00
Kyle McMartin
de60a19848
turn on %aarch64patches
2015-02-17 14:16:28 -05:00
Kyle McMartin
739741434f
fix build on aarch64 with gcc5
2015-02-17 13:36:20 -05:00
Josh Boyer
08f431fa3a
Linux v3.19-7478-g796e1c55717e
...
- DRM merge
2015-02-17 10:18:24 -05:00
Josh Boyer
c438599162
CVE-XXXX-XXXX potential memory corruption in vhost/scsi driver (rhbz 1189864 1192079)
2015-02-16 14:39:46 -05:00
Josh Boyer
d2fb0bf021
CVE-2015-1593 stack ASLR integer overflow (rhbz 1192519 1192520)
2015-02-16 14:13:37 -05:00